A leading engineering services provider is seeking a Product Safety Engineer for their Bristol site. The role involves ensuring the safety and compliance of mission-critical systems, conducting safety assessments, and supporting system design integration.

Candidates should have:

  • A degree in engineering
  • Familiarity with safety standards
  • Experience in a high-integrity environment

This full-time role offers flexible hybrid working arrangements and requires security clearance. Competitive salary and benefits included.
